O Que Eles Fazem
A SOLV Energy é especializada em energia solar em grande escala e armazenamento de energia, oferecendo serviços abrangentes que incluem engenharia, aquisição e construção (EPC) para projetos de energia solar fotovoltaica (PV) e armazenamento em bateria. Suas operações também incluem manutenção contínua (O&M) para ativos solares ativos, construção de subestações de alta tensão e gerenciamento de construção. Os serviços EPC da empresa cobrem uma ampla gama de atividades, incluindo preparação de locais, engenharia estrutural, instalação de painéis e inversores, integração de sistemas elétricos e interconexão à rede (fonte: zoominfo.com). A SOLV Energy tem como alvo principal desenvolvedores de energia em grande escala, produtores independentes de energia e clientes comerciais e industriais que requerem implantações em larga escala de 50 megawatts (MW) ou mais por projeto, focando no mercado dos EUA (fonte: american-securities.com). A empresa se diferencia por sua execução de projetos de ponta a ponta, aproveitando sua herança da construção Swinerton para integrar a experiência em contratação geral com tecnologia renovável especializada.
Projetos & Histórico
A SOLV Energy possui um histórico impressionante, tendo construído mais de 18 gigawatts (GW) de capacidade solar em 34 estados até 2024, enquanto também fornece serviços de O&M para mais de 15 GW de ativos solares na América do Norte (fonte: american-securities.com). A empresa está atualmente envolvida em grandes projetos que aproveitam sua capacidade expandida após a fusão com a CS Energy, focando em energia solar e armazenamento em grande escala em regiões de alto crescimento, como Califórnia, Texas e Sudeste. Essa expansão é apoiada por um pipeline de desenvolvimento de múltiplos GW, indicando um futuro robusto para a empresa (fonte: zoominfo.com). Os principais clientes incluem desenvolvedores solares líderes e concessionárias, com parcerias formais estabelecidas para aprimorar a entrega de serviços e as capacidades de execução de projetos.
Desenvolvimentos Recentes
Nos últimos anos, a SOLV Energy fez avanços significativos, incluindo uma parceria com a CS Energy anunciada em outubro de 2024, com o objetivo de ampliar as capacidades geográficas e o suporte aos funcionários, culminando em sua combinação de negócios em 2024 (fonte: zoominfo.com). Em 15 de janeiro de 2025, a empresa adquiriu a SDI Services, uma empresa de perfuração de fundações, o que aprimora suas capacidades de execução de projetos em energias renováveis ao adicionar mão de obra qualificada e capacidade de equipamentos (fonte: sdbj.com). Além disso, a SOLV Energy lançou sua terceira bolsa de estudos anual PowerUp! em Energias Renováveis em 16 de janeiro de 2025, concedendo $1.500 a seis alunos do ensino médio dos EUA que buscam carreiras na área de energia, refletindo seu compromisso com o desenvolvimento da força de trabalho (fonte: zoominfo.com).

Job Description
This role is located full-time on a jobsite in Refugio, TX. Specific location details and expectations will be discussed during the interview process.
This job description reflects management's assignment of essential functions; it does not prescribe or restrict the tasks that may be assigned.
Position Responsibilities and Duties
- Stresses the importance that safety is the most important function, ensuring that all employees follow safe practices while working
- Able to perform all essential Field Service Technician Levels 1-4 job responsibilities
- Preform, direct, and supervise site maintenance, repair, troubleshooting as directed by management, adhering to company and industry safety standards
- Ensure a safe working environment through strict adherence to and enforcement of company and industry safety standards
- Implement repairs to unfamiliar solar equipment, systems and plants with a minimum amount of training and familiarization safely
- Direct and take responsibility for safety regulations and work procedures for the team
- Understand, follow and communicate safety regulations and work procedures
- Supervise and provide ongoing training for Solar Technician Level I, II, III, and IV employees
- Prepare timely and accurate documentation and required reports related to site operation
- Assessing and suggest improved processes, collaborate on new technologies, and coordinate with EPC management regarding the implementation of these improvements
- Uphold diversity and inclusion as an unconscious part of SOLV Energy culture.

Minimum Skills or Experience Requirements
- High School Diploma or General Equivalency Diploma (GED) or equivalent, Vocational/Technical School training a plus
- Minimum four years of experience in solar facility maintenance and repair
- Demonstrate advanced computer operation skills and ability to operate system monitoring applications
- Advanced working knowledge of solar systems/plants, protection devices, control devices, power supplies, loads, conductors, inverters and transformers
- Ability to troubleshoot network and telemetry issues
- Ability to pass an exam on international and domestic electrical schematics and symbols
- Ability to pass an exam on electrical troubleshooting
- Ability to pass an exam on reading and interpreting hydraulic and pneumatic diagrams
- Effective computer operation skills and ability to operate system monitoring applications
- Valid OSHA 30 certification
- Valid NFPA 70e Safety Training certification
- Remain Current in all safety and technical trainings
- Demonstrated ability to be self-sufficient and safe under any conditions
- Effective verbal and written English language communication skills
- Effective organizational skills
- To work well with PM, management, OCC, HV, SCADA, Performance, Networking/IT, Compliance teams
- Ability to work at remote locations in extreme weather conditions (heat, cold, inclement weather)
- Ability to work on an "on call" basis (may include weekends or after-hours situations)
- Ability to work with other techs to be able to complete tasks with these team members
- Valid driver's license, satisfactory driving record and ability to operate company vehicle
- Ability to assess safety items and issue Stop Work if concerns are raised
